RUMFORD – The River Valley Technology Center, the River Valley Growth Council and the River Valley Chamber of Commerce will present a new series of business lunch and learn seminars.

The first in a series of six will take place from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. Wednesday, Jan. 18, at the River Valley Technology Center, 60 Lowell St. The cost of $10 includes lunch. Preregistration is required by calling Beverly at 369-0396 or e-mail beverly@rvcg.org by Friday, Jan. 13.

The first topic will be “Business Planning – Part I” presented by Greg Gould. Gould is a certified business counselor in the Auburn office of the Maine Small Business Development Center hosted by the Androscoggin Council of Governments. He has years of experience working with small and large businesses.

The prebusiness workshop includes discussion on the basic qualities of entrepreneurs; defining a business plan; basics of marketing; and introduction to business financial planning.

The Lunch and Learn seminars are intended to provide information to entrepreneurs, start-ups and existing businesses in an affordable way. Anyone can gather resources and information for long-term success. In addition, the seminars are intended to facilitate networking among businesses or entrepreneurs in similar activities.
